カスタム ContentProvider を使用してゲーム内のハイスコアを提供しようとしています。SQLite DB の代わりにサーバー接続を使用します。
現在、ContentProvider のquery()、update()、およびdelete()メソッドには、 selection、selectionArgs、およびsortOrderパラメータがあります。問題は、それらをどのように解析するかです。この単純なアプリに重い SQL 文法解析ライブラリを追加したくありません。
インターネット上の人々は RESTProvider について言及しています: https://github.com/novoda/RESTProvider。私が探しているもののように見えましたが、関連するコードが欠落していることが判明しました。
そもそもハイスコアに ContentProvider を使用したいのはなぜですか? カーソルは Android で優れたサポートを提供しているため、他の関連アプリでも役立つ可能性があります。